Course Information

Develop knowledge of allergies and what to do in the event of an allergic
reaction with our Level 2 Allergy Awareness for Those Working in Adult Social
Care course. Perfect for both individuals working in an adult social care role
looking to upskill, and employers looking for allergy awareness training online
courses for their staff, this course covers everything you need.


This course has been designed to provide skills and knowledge in a range of
subjects related to allergies. These include the different types of allergens,
allergies and intolerances, food labelling and packaging, how to recognise
reactions, how to reduce risks, how to provide first aid, and
more.
